If I wire the basement with GFI receptacles, is there anyway that the
receptacle can be broken so that one half of the duplex could be used
to control lighting in the room ?

Thanks


Assuming you want to split the tops from bottoms and have wall switch
control of half of each outlet, no, GFCI outlets are not made that way. If
it's a finished basement, there is no NEC requirement to use GFCI outlets.
You can however use GFCI protection for the entire circuit or circuits, then
split standard duplex outlets and switches
